October vs the best time to visit Phu Quoc
The best months to visit Phu Quoc are November, December, January, February, March. October sits outside peak season, which often means better value and thinner crowds.

Sao Beach
A postcard-perfect white-sand beach on the island's southeast coast, with shallow turquoise water.
Long Beach
A long stretch of sand near Duong Dong town, lined with resorts and popular for sunset viewing.
Phu Quoc Night Market
A bustling seafood and street food market in Duong Dong, popular for fresh grilled seafood and local snacks.
An Thoi Islands
A cluster of small islands south of Phu Quoc, popular for snorkelling day trips and squid fishing tours.
Hon Thom Cable Car
The world's longest three-rope cable car, crossing the sea to Hon Thom Island in about 15 minutes.
Pepper Farm Visit
Tours of Phu Quoc's famous pepper plantations, with tastings of the island's prized black and red peppercorns.
